How to conjugate multiplicar in Subjunctive Future in Spanish

multiplicar
to multiply
regular verb

Multiplicar means to perform the mathematical operation of multiplication or to increase something in number or amount. It is used in contexts involving calculation, growth, or expansion.

How to conjugate multiplicar in Subjunctive Future

El Futuro de Subjuntivo - used to speak about hypothetical situations and actions/events that may happen in the future
